一、流的分类
1.按操作数据的单位不同分为:字节流(8bit),字符流(16bit)。
2.按数据流的流向不同分为:输入流,输出流。
3.按流的角色的不同分为:节点流(直接作用于文件),处理流(外面套了层管子)。
图片说明
上述四个类都是抽象类,不能实例化。
图片说明
图片说明
操作的四步走:
// 1.File类的实例化
File file = new File("hello.txt");

// 2.FileReader流的实例化
FileReader fr = new FileReader(file);

// 3.读入的具体的操作细节

// 4.资源的关闭